Background:
- Clopidogrel is a crucial antiplatelet agent for preventing thrombotic events in acute coronary syndrome and ischemic stroke.
- Dual antiplatelet therapy (DAPT) is standard for stroke patients, but potential side effects require careful consideration.
Observation:
- A male patient developed inflammatory arthritis five days after initiating maintenance clopidogrel for stroke treatment.
- Extensive workup for common and autoimmune causes of inflammatory arthritis yielded negative results.
Findings:
- The patient's inflammatory arthritis was hypothesized to be induced by clopidogrel.
- Discontinuation of clopidogrel led to complete resolution of arthritis symptoms.
Implications:
- Drug-induced arthritis should be considered in patients presenting with inflammatory arthritis, especially those on new medications like clopidogrel.
- A thorough differential diagnosis is essential, as medication-induced arthritis is a diagnosis of exclusion.
- Risk-benefit assessment of DAPT in ischemic stroke patients with pre-existing rheumatoid arthritis is recommended in consultation with neurology.
Abstract:
Clopidogrel is an antiplatelet medication that plays an important role in the management and prevention of thrombotic vascular events in patients with acute coronary syndrome (ACS) and ischemic stroke. We report a case of a male patient who received a maintenance dose of clopidogrel as part of stroke treatment and developed inflammatory arthritis after five days of starting the medication. He underwent extensive evaluation and testing to explore other common causes of inflammatory arthritis, including autoimmune etiologies. None of the test results were helpful, and we hypothesized that his arthritis was induced by clopidogrel. Discontinuing this agent resulted in the complete resolution of the patient's symptoms. Since medication-induced arthritis is a diagnosis of exclusion, these patients should undergo a complete workup for inflammatory arthritis. If possible, a risk-benefit analysis of dual antiplatelet therapy (DAPT) in ischemic stroke patients with a prior history of rheumatoid arthritis (RA) should be done in collaboration with neurology.
